Posts

Ki Eun PyoKi Eun Pyo
Took about 1-2 hours to hike around the area. As of 4/16/2023, we saw a nice blooming mustard field before passing the entrance, and they don't allow parking near the mustard field so you would need to either park the vehicle inside the park or away from the area. Also, there are lots of golden poppy flowers on the hills facing the water, but unfortunately the majority are not too visible because they have been outgrown by other non-flowering plants. However, there are other types of flowers that adds beauty to this wonderful park. Tip: Entrance was clogged up due to high demand, and there was no one at the kiosk so we had to pay with credit card using the vending machine.
Bishal KarkiBishal Karki
Moderate to steep hike. Various hiking trail to take. super blossom with wild flowers all over the route. Need to pay for vehicle parking inside $5 but if you choose to walk a bit you can park just opposite of the coyote hill entrances,curb side parking. Look for busy hours ,may need to wait to enter because of parking payment and single kiosk in operation.
Siddharth ReddySiddharth Reddy
About 40mins drive from Walnut Creek, CA. Beautiful state park that has great trails with exceptional views of the bay. Entry fee is $5 per day for cars. More than ample parking spots and super helpful visitor center (It has restrooms/drinking water). They have plenty of picnic tables and restrooms throughout the state park.
